Center for Economic and Social Development, or CESD; in Azeri, İqtisadi və Sosial İnkişaf Mərkəzi (İSİM) is an Azeri think tank, non-profit organization, NGO based in Baku, Azerbaijan.The Center was established in 2005. The Centre is now considered as one of the important subsidiary organs of OIC in charge of promoting socio-economic development in the context of advancing intra-OIC cooperation in the relevant areas of its mandate, namely statistics, economic and social research and training and technical cooperation.
